The word vocal can be an adjective and a noun.

The adjective form describes something pertaining to the voice.

The noun form is a vocal element of speech.

Vibration that results in speech is a function of the?

Vibration that results in speech is a function of the vocal cords within the larynx. When air is pushed from the lungs through the vocal cords, they vibrate and create sound waves that form the basis of speech. The vibration frequency and how the vocal cords are manipulated determine the specific sounds produced.

The part of the respiratory system that helps us speak is?

The larynx, also known as the voice box, is the part of the respiratory system responsible for producing sound and enabling speech. It contains the vocal cords, which vibrate as air passes through, producing sound waves that we perceive as speech. The manipulation of airflow and tension in the vocal cords helps create different pitches and tones.
